Default Re: Seller of car not same as name on the title - Is that legal?

well, I'll admit that when I bought my first 3/S, that's what happened... i bought it from a place called "cash for cars," and it didn't have the "dealership" guy's name on it, it had the guy he bought it from. The dealership guy just put my name on it as the buyer, and it looked like he never owned it.

Which is great for him, because he didn't have to pay taxes on it, no doubt. I was young and dumb when I bought my first 3/S, though, so I'd never do that again now... it's Shady, to be honest.

Ask the seller for the previous buyer's info and give him a call. Talk to him. If the seller is on the level, he'll happily provide you with that info, and he'll HAVE it all handy and accessible. Only someone shady or trying to rip you off would withhold that info or say they don't have it.

For all you know, he marked up the car $5,000 and is just trying to make a quick profit. Then again, maybe he bought a car with issues that the other seller disclosed, and he isn't. A ten minute phone call could take care of a lot of worry.
